What to Expect from the Tour

One Day E-Bike Tour In The Colorado Rockies - What to Expect from the Tour

This isn’t your average bike ride. It’s a thoughtfully designed adventure that balances scenic beauty with local discovery. Starting with pickup from Denver (around 9:00 AM, with some variation based on your location), you’ll travel approximately an hour and fifteen minutes into the Colorado Rockies. During this drive, you get to anticipate the stunning landscapes ahead.

Once you reach your starting point, you’ll hop on well-maintained e-bikes. The electric assist makes pedaling through hilly terrain and historic roads effortless, allowing you to focus on the views rather than sweating it out. The tour’s main highlight is riding into Boulder Canyon, which offers dramatic cliffs and rugged scenery. You’ll love the way the wind feels as you cruise through these mountain environments, feeling truly alive and connected to nature.

The tour doesn’t just tick scenic boxes; it also takes you along the Switzerland Trail, an historic route that adds a touch of Colorado’s past to your experience. The blend of natural grandeur and historic roads makes the ride interesting and varied.

After about three hours of riding, you’ll arrive in Nederland, a charming mountain town known for its quirky character and lively local scene. Here, you’ll get some free time to explore, grab snacks or drinks, and enjoy the vibrant atmosphere. The highlight in Nederland is a visit to a local brewery, where you can toast your adventure and relax after the ride.

The Logistics: Transportation and Timing

The tour is a private group, so you won’t be sharing with strangers, which is a nice touch for a more personalized experience. The transportation from Denver is included, making logistical planning simpler. The total duration, including transfer, riding, and brewery stop, is approximately 6 to 7 hours.

You’ll be contacted a day before the tour with your pickup time, which varies slightly depending on your location. Starting at 9:00 AM, the schedule allows enough time to fully experience the scenery and town without feeling rushed.

FAQ

Is this tour suitable for beginners?
Yes, the e-bike assistance makes it accessible for beginners. You don’t need to be an experienced cyclist to enjoy the ride.

How long is the drive from Denver?
The drive from Denver to the starting point is approximately one hour and fifteen minutes, depending on traffic and your pickup location.

What should I bring on the tour?
You should bring sunglasses, sunscreen, water, and comfortable clothes suitable for biking and outdoor weather.

Is the tour private or group-based?
It’s a private group experience, so you’ll be riding with your own small group rather than strangers.

What does the tour include?
The price covers e-bike rental and helmet, transportation, water and snacks, and guiding services.

Can I cancel the booking?
Yes, you can cancel up to 24 hours in advance for a full refund.

How long is the total tour?
Expect around 6 to 7 hours including pickup, riding, and the brewery visit.

What’s the highlight of the tour?
Most travelers love the combination of riding into Boulder Canyon, enjoying mountain views, and ending with a brewery stop in Nederland.

Is it suitable for children?
The tour is designed for adults; while not specifically family-oriented, it could be suitable for responsible older teens comfortable with biking.
